Aly Eltayb

Co-founder and
CEO of Shift EV

Aly Eltayeb is the co-founder and CEO of Shift EV, an electric mobility startup based in Cairo, focused on electrifying fleets in emerging markets through manufacturing grade and speed retrofitting with lego packs the company designs and manufactures. The company's technology is currently deployed with leading last mile logistics fleets, under a battery as a service subscription model. Shift EV is led by an MIT / Intel / GM and backed by Union Square Ventures and other global venture investors. 

Prior to Shift EV, Aly led the business development and analytics team at Form Energy, a long duration storage startup based in Boston, USA that has raised
$800mn in financing. Aly joined as the 8th employee where he led the company's market discovery, and the development of a grid optimization analytics platform to engage customers on big battery projects. Aly led the contracting of a first-of-a-kind grid scale long duration power project with a US utility, and the development of a multi GWh global pipeline of projects. Before Form Energy, Aly was an early stage innovation manager at Corning, a Fortune 500 in the material science space, where he was responsible for the assessment of
investment opportunities in automotive and consumer electronics. 

 Prior to that, Aly developed a novel electrochemical carbon capture technology at MIT raising $1.65mn of non-dilutive funding to support R&D for commercialization. Aly holds a PhD in Chemical Engineering and MBA in Finance from the Massachusetts Institute of Technology and is a Cairo University graduate.

Hicham Arafa

Chief Operations Officer at Brightskies Inc. 

Eng.Hicham Arafa brings 29 years of Engineering Management experience, where he has led and contributed to the building of many leading technology companies in Egypt. Hicham Has been the Chief Operations Officer and Partner for Brightskies since the year 2017, where he has successfully steered the growth of the company from 40 engineers to 400+ engineers in 2023.

Prior to joining Brightskies, Arafa was the R&D director and Deputy General Manager for Valeo Egypt, where he spent 6 years growing
Valeo’s engineering capacity and making it the biggest software development center in Egypt and in the region, employing more than 2000 Engineers and serving all of Valeo’s Business Groups under one roof.

Prior to his role at Valeo, Arafa worked with Intel
Corporation as the Business Development Manager for Egypt, Levant and North Africa, where he opened multiple offices for Intel in Algeria, Morocco and Libya. Prior to that Hicham served as the Strategic Initiatives Manager for Intel’s Platform Definition Center based in Cairo, which was one of the four unique technical centers that Intel opened worldwide to define, plan and develop specific products for the Middle East, Turkey and Africa region.

Arafa started off his career at Intel in the USA in 1999, where he held numerous positions including Validation Architect at the Enterprise Server Group, the Embedded Intel Architecture Division, when he
finally returned to Egypt in 2003 to work for the Sales and Marketing Group.

Hicham is a Boad Member in several industry development companies and organizations, and is playing an active role to bridge the gap
between the Automotive and the ICT industries in Egypt.

 He is a member of the Board Of Directors of Silicon Waha since 2019, a Board Member of EiTESAL NGO
since 2022 and a Board Member in the Egyptian Environment-Friendly Automotive Industry Development Fund since 2023. He was born in Cairo 1971 and received his B.Sc in Electrical Communications from Cairo University in 1994, his MSEE in high performance computing from West Virginia University in 1998, and his MBA in Technology Management from the W.P.Carey school of business at Arizona State University in 2003.
